What Ground Clearance Advantages Do 8.5-Inch Tires Provide?

The primary reason an off road hoverboard 8.5 inch model handles rough surfaces so effectively comes down to simple geometry: wheel diameter directly dictates ground clearance and obstacle rollover capability.

1. Elevated Underbody Clearance

Standard 6.5-inch hoverboards position the bottom plastic chassis just 1.0 to 1.2 inches above the ground. When riding across uneven surfaces—such as overgrown grass, dirt trails, or unpaved driveways—the underside of a small board constantly drags against the terrain, causing mechanical drag or sudden stops. In contrast, an 8.5 inch wheel hoverboard raises the underbody chassis to roughly 2.0 to 2.5 inches off the ground. This extra height allows the board to clear rocks, tree roots, and curb lips without scraping the battery housing.

2. Reduced Obstacle Approach Angle

A larger wheel hits bumps at a shallower angle than a smaller wheel. When an 8.5-inch tire meets a 1-inch crack or pebble in the pavement, the wheel rolls over it smoothly rather than slamming into it directly. This smooth rollover effect provides several benefits:

  • Improved Rider Balance: Less shock is transferred through the footpads to the rider's legs.
  • Enhanced Traction: The wider rubber tread maintains continuous contact with loose dirt and wet grass.
  • Chassis Protection: Prevents cosmetic scratches and structural cracking on the outer wheel arches and lower shell.

Motor Wattage Requirements for Climbing Slopes Smoothly

Larger wheels require more mechanical rotational force (torque) to maintain momentum, especially when pushing through soft dirt or climbing steep inclines.

Standard 6.5-inch commuter hoverboards typically rely on modest 250W to 300W dual motors (500W–600W total). While sufficient for flat indoor floors, these lower-wattage motors struggle on outdoor inclines and thick grass, often overheating or drawing high battery power.

Maintaining Correct Tire Pressure for Off-Road Traction

Depending on the specific model variation, 8.5-inch off-road hoverboards utilize either solid puncture-proof rubber tires with aggressive mud treads or heavy-duty pneumatic (air-filled) tires. If your 8.5-inch board features pneumatic tires, maintaining proper tire pressure is essential for optimal ride quality and rim protection.

Recommended Tire Pressure Guidelines

For 8.5-inch pneumatic hoverboard tires, riders should maintain a tire pressure between 30 to 36 PSI (2.0 to 2.5 bar).

  • Under-Inflated Tires (<28 PSI): Cause sluggish acceleration, increased rolling resistance, higher battery consumption, and a higher risk of pinch flats or rim damage when hitting hard rocks or curb edges.
  • Over-Inflated Tires (>38 PSI): Reduce the rubber contact patch with the ground, leading to a harsh, bouncy ride and decreased grip on loose gravel or wet grass.
  • Optimal Inflation (30–36 PSI): Delivers the ideal balance between cushioned shock absorption over bumps and firm sidewall stability during sharp turns.

What tire pressure should be maintained on 8.5-inch pneumatic tires?

For 8.5-inch pneumatic hoverboard tires, recommended tire pressure is between 30 to 36 PSI (2.0 to 2.5 bar). Keeping tires within this range provides optimal shock absorption over rough terrain while preserving battery efficiency and preventing rim damage.
